Radiation emitted by smartphones is typically in the form of electromagnetic fields (EMFs), which are a type of non-ionizing radiation. While the World Health Organization (WHO) states that there is no conclusive evidence linking exposure to EMFs from smartphones to adverse health effects, some studies have suggested a potential link to increased risk of certain health conditions, such as cancer and infertility.
One of the primary concerns regarding radiation from smartphones is the impact it can have on brain health. As smartphones are held close to the head during use, there is a potential for the radiation to penetrate the brain tissue. While the amount of radiation emitted by smartphones is considered to be relatively low, long-term exposure could potentially pose a risk, particularly for children and adolescents whose brains are still developing.
To address these concerns, manufacturers have implemented various measures to reduce radiation exposure from smartphones. One common feature found in many smartphones is the SAR (Specific Absorption Rate) value, which measures the rate at which the body absorbs radiation from a particular device. Consumers can use this value as a guide when selecting a smartphone with lower SAR values to minimize radiation exposure.

In addition to using accessories for radiation protection, there are several simple steps that smartphone users can take to minimize their exposure to radiation. One such measure is to use the speakerphone or a hands-free device when making calls to keep the phone away from the head. Users can also limit the amount of time spent on their smartphones and take breaks to reduce overall exposure to radiation.
Another important consideration for radiation protection is the location of the smartphone during use. Placing the device in a pocket or close to the body can result in increased radiation exposure. Therefore, it is recommended to keep the smartphone at a distance whenever possible, such as placing it on a table or using a wireless headset to reduce direct contact with the device.
